Bettina Dorfmann, from Dusseldorf, Germany, has the largest collection of Barbies in the world
Ms Dorfmann keeps an extensive array of Barbie arms, legs and other spare parts at the ready, as well as paints in various shades to touch up the dolls’ discoloured lip shades and skin tones. She even takes old outfits apart to reuse their tiny buttons and zips.
Her Barbie hospital is equipped with magnifying glasses to help focus on the delicate work and a range of glues. “There are so many different Barbie models and body shapes, different hand sizes, and the skin tone varies greatly,” the doll enthusiast says. Customers are typically collectors for whom Barbies can be big business. Second-hand dolls can sell at auction for prices ranging from a few pounds to more than £20,000 for original first-edition dolls in mint condition. The Barbie hospital also gets frequent enquiries from nostalgic owners wanting their childhood toys repaired.
“My clients come from Germany, France, the Netherlands, Italy, Switzerland, England and Sweden. Collectors will travel Europe-wide to trade fairs. I do repair work every month and get enquiries coming in by post. There’s always something to do.”Ms Dorfmann’s Barbie expertise now goes far beyond doll restoration. A leading authority on the subject, she can provide certified appraisals of the dolls’ value for insurance purposes.
